Webb17 sep. 2024 · Kappa opioid receptor (KOR) is a subtype of opioid receptors and a member of the G protein-coupled receptor family, that is mainly distributed in central nervous tissues. Citation 5 Its mRNA expression is found in rats’ hippocampal dentate gyrus, hypothalamus and spinal cord.
Webb19 dec. 2014 · 1. JDTic. This is a new (KOR) kappa-opioid receptor antagonist with long-lasting effects and extremely selective properties. In other words, its effects are limited to the kappa receptor and it doesn’t tend to affect the mu or delta receptors.
